Top 5 2D Realistic Games in Chile Q4 2023: Performance Overview

In the fourth quarter of 2023, the top 5 2D realistic games in Chile showcased notable trends across down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. Here’s a breakdown of their performance, sourced from Sensor Tower.

Evony from TOP GAMES INC. experienced fluctuating revenue, peaking at around $8.1K in the last week of November. Downloads were highest in the weeks of October 9 and December 25, reaching approximately 5.2K each. The game’s weekly active users showed some decline, starting at 17.5K in late September and ending the quarter at around 17.9K.

Rise of Castles: Fire and War by LONG TECH NETWORK LIMITED had a peak revenue of $8.3K in late September, with another high of $8.1K at the end of October. Downloads peaked at 187 in the week of October 23. The weekly active users saw a gradual decline from 5.1K at the end of September to about 3.9K by the end of December.

Dream League Soccer 2024 from First Touch Games Ltd. showed a strong revenue increase, climbing to $8.7K in mid-December. The game’s downloads peaked impressively at 10.1K in early December. Weekly active users saw a significant rise, reaching about 64.5K in early December before stabilizing around 57.9K by the end of the quarter.

8 Ball Pool™ by Miniclip.com maintained consistent revenue, peaking at $7.9K in early October. Downloads remained robust, with a peak of 12.5K in late December. The game sustained high weekly active users throughout the quarter, peaking at approximately 219.6K in the last week of December.

Last Shelter: Survival, also from LONG TECH NETWORK LIMITED, saw its revenue peak at around $6K in late December. The game had a notable spike in downloads in late October, reaching around 1.5K. Weekly active users saw a significant increase, peaking at approximately 1.5K in late October before settling at around 1.3K by the end of December.
